The `pyfe3d` module is a general-purpose finite element solver for structural analysis and optimization based on Python and Cython. The main principles guiding the development of `pyfe3d` are: simplicity, efficiency and compatibility. The aimed level of compatibility allows one to run this solver in any platform, including the Google Colab environment.
